Are you an experienced Stock and Materials Planner with a background in a Manufacturing or Engineering environment?
Are you looking for a new and exciting role?
We are looking for an experienced Stock and Materials Planner with fantastic organisation skills to join our client, a forward-thinking business who have state of the art facilities.

Duties include:
• Overall responsibility for end-to-end stock planning ensuring effective production planning and budget control
• Raising and completing all purchase orders by calculating the required stock and materials needed.
• Creating Bill of Materials
• Ensuring all components are on course to meet the required delivery times.
• Reporting on all stock control and confidently and effectively make adjustments where necessary.
• Working closely with managers to meet deadlines and ensure the smooth production of orders.
• Any other duties required.

The successful candidate will have:
• Previous experience in a stock and material planning role within Manufacturing, Construction or Engineering.
• The ability to read technical drawings.
• An understanding of components in order to determine the most effective ones for use.
• Excellent organisation and communication skills.
• Able to work and communicate effectively with other teams.
• An analytic way of working, in order to work to, and meet strict deadlines.
• Knowledge of computer systems, including excellent Excel skills – using formulas and functions as a minimum.
• Excellent numeracy skills with the ability to make accurate calculations.
• Happy to work in an office environment but with movement to the Production facility where necessary to physically stock check if needed.
